An online e-learning portal which contains all the available resources at one place for Tamil medium students in Sri Lanka

For the past 2 months, COVID 19 has brought drastic changes in the whole world. In Sri Lanka, the government has imposed back to back curfews to reduce the gatherings of people. Therefore, most of the people started to work from home. In the student perspective, some teachers started to teach using modern technologies like WhatsApp/Viber to send notes and other needed resources as different formats like videos and PDF contents.


A group of open-minded people from Jaffna gathered a meeting through Zoom every Saturday at 2 PM (IST) to discuss e-learning for Tamil medium students in Sri Lanka. Lots of members from Charity and Non-profit organization members are giving their support on this discussion.

They have taken 2 main action items on improving e-learning during the past meetings
  1. Creating an online portal that contains all the list of resources for students in Tamil.
  2. Conducting a workshop for teachers on how they can improve their teaching ability using Technology devices.
https://tamilkalvi.online/ is an online portal created to list out all the available resources for students and teachers to get to know. Interestingly this site has got a huge interest among students and teachers.

Currently, the workshop is happening. Til now 2 workshops about how to handle technology devices and how to use google classroom effectively were held among teachers.190 teachers were registered for the workshop and out of that 120 teachers participated.

Still, these open-minded people are having these meetings on how they can improve and support their society by educating future leaders of the Earth.
